Dear Susan. To easily thread most needles, lay a length of thread over the shaft of the needle & pull sharply, grasping both thread ends firmly between thumb & forefinger. Slide the crisply folded thread off the shaft & lay the eye of the needle over the fold you are pinching. If the thread doesn’t pop up thru the eye, flip the needle over & try the other side.
My mother taught us this and said it was the way a blind person could thread a needle (that was back in the 50s)!!
